What Is an Automobile Odometer?
An automobile odometer is a measuring device installed in vehicles to display the total distance traveled. It is usually located on the dashboard near the speedometer and provides drivers with information about vehicle usage.
The displayed mileage helps owners track maintenance schedules, estimate vehicle wear, and understand the overall usage history of their car.

How Does an Automobile Odometer Work?
Modern odometers use advanced electronic systems connected to vehicle sensors, while older vehicles used mechanical systems.
Mechanical Odometers
Traditional mechanical odometers use gears connected to the vehicle’s wheel rotation system. As the wheels move, the gears calculate distance and display the accumulated mileage.
Digital Odometers
Most modern vehicles use digital odometers. These systems collect information from electronic sensors and store mileage data within the vehicle’s computer system.
Digital systems provide greater accuracy and integration with other vehicle technologies, but they also require professional tools for verification.

Odometer Fraud and Mileage Tampering
Odometer fraud occurs when someone changes the displayed mileage to make a vehicle appear less used than it actually is. This practice can mislead buyers and affect vehicle value.

How to Check an Automobile Odometer Before Buying
Before purchasing a used vehicle, consider these steps:
1. Review Service Records
Maintenance documents can reveal whether recorded mileage matches previous service visits.
2. Inspect Vehicle Condition
Interior wear, steering condition, pedals, and seats can provide clues about actual vehicle usage.
3. Use Professional Inspection Services
Experts can check electronic records and identify inconsistencies between displayed mileage and stored vehicle information.
4. Check Vehicle History
Accident records, registration history, and previous ownership information can help verify a vehicle’s background.

Difference Between Mileage and Vehicle Condition
Although mileage is important, it does not always determine vehicle quality. A well-maintained car with higher mileage can sometimes be more reliable than a poorly maintained vehicle with lower mileage.
Buyers should consider:
- Maintenance history
- Driving conditions
- Previous ownership
- Engine and transmission condition
- Inspection results
